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Step 1: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). Pat chicken breasts dry with paper towels, then season both sides with 1/2 tsp salt and 1/4 tsp black pepper.
  2. Step 2: In a small bowl, whisk together 3 tbsp honey, 2 tbsp soy sauce, and 3 minced garlic cloves until smooth.
  3. Step 3: Place carrots and zucchini in a single lay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Drizzle with 2 tbsp olive oil, sprinkle with 1 tsp dried thyme, 1/2 tsp salt, and 1/4 tsp black pepper, then toss to coat evenly.
  4. Step 4: Arrange seasoned chicken breasts on top of the vegetables. Brush each chicken piece generously with the honey-soy glaze mixture.
  5. Step 5: Roast for 22-25 minutes until chicken reaches 165°F (74°C) internally and vegetables are tender with golden edges, basting once halfway through with remaining glaze.
  6. Step 6: Let rest 5 minutes before serving to allow juices to redistribute.

How do I store leftover Honey-Soy Glazed Chicken with Crispy Roasted Vegetables?

Cool to room temperature within 2 hours, then store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Reheat covered in a 350°F oven for 10-12 minutes, or microwave at 70% power in 60-second bursts to keep honey from drying out.

How do I scale Honey-Soy Glazed Chicken with Crispy Roasted Vegetables for a different number of people?

The recipe is written for 4 servings. Multiply each ingredient by (your serving target / 4). Cook time stays roughly the same up to 2x; for 3-4x batches, switch from a skillet to a sheet pan or stockpot so the food isn't crowded — overcrowding steams instead of browns.
